For wheelchair users, the shoulders become one of the most important parts of their body.

Manual wheelchair users especially, rely on their shoulders to not only push but tasks such as transferring. Even a powerchair user will use their shoulders a significant amount.

Shoulders were never designed to work this hard, which makes them prone to damage and injury.
